 Hello friends and Happy New Year.  This is Seize the Birthday's first challenge for 2022 and Colleen has chosen Blue and Gray for our "Toppings" option this time. I think blue and gray is a lovely color combination.





I have used PTI Gran's Garden for the flowers and leaves in Balmy Blue and Smokey Slate.  The light shade is stamped off once and the darker shade is full strength Balmy Blue.  I used the matching dies to cut them out.  The flowers are mounted with foam tape and the leaves glued to the white panel, which is die cut with The Greetery Deco Frames die.  The sentiment is from Waffle Flower Essential Sentiments Stamp & Die set stamped in Basic Gray ink.  This is all mounted on a Smokey Slate card base.
